BUG FIX

A fatal "Out of stack space" error would occur if an attempt was made to directly set the Lo1 or Lo2 slider in the BP4 or BP6 loudspeaker wizard to a value greater than the smaller of Lc1 or Lc2, while the Auto option was selected. Operational problems also arose if values were directly entered into the sliders with the Manual option selected.

The bug has now been fixed.
